# Visual Analysis of Photo Policy Misconfigurations Using Treemaps

**Authors:** Yousra Javed, Mohamed Shehab

arXiv: 1903.02612 · 2019-03-08

## TL;DR

This paper introduces a visualization tool that uses Treemaps to help users identify and fix privacy misconfigurations in photo sharing policies on social media platforms.

## Contribution

It presents a novel Treemap-based visualization approach specifically designed for detecting and addressing photo policy misconfigurations.

## Key findings

- Effective identification of privacy misconfigurations
- Enhanced user understanding of photo sharing policies
- Facilitates quick fixing of privacy issues

## Abstract

Online photo privacy is a major concern for social media users. Numerous visualization tools have been proposed to help the users easily compose and understand policies on social networks. However, these tools do not incorporate the ability to quickly identify and fix unintended photo sharing. We propose a tool that displays the photo albums w.r.t their policy misconfigurations using a Treemap visualization.
